About Us:
General Shale Brick is the legacy brand of General Shale established in 1928. The brand is available through nine production sites and 17 distribution centers across North America. The brand includes industry-renowned products including many popular colors and textures, which continue to be in high-demand for unique residential and commercial projects.
Position Summary:
The Safety Specialist is responsible for coordinating, promoting, and monitoring company-wide safety efforts, ensuring compliance with all relevant regulatory standards, and partnering with facility leadership to continuously improve workplace safety. This role requires frequent travel to various General Shale sites in Texas, Oklahoma, Arkansas, and Colorado.
Key Responsibilities:
-
Coordinate, promote, and monitor safety programs and initiatives across multiple sites.
-
Ensure compliance with OSHA and MSHA requirements.
-
Advise and support manufacturing and engineering teams during the implementation of new equipment, processes, and procedures.
-
Lead and facilitate employee safety training and educational programs.
-
Administer, evaluate, and continuously improve all company safety programs.
-
Maintain accurate, up-to-date safety records and provide timely reporting and correspondence as directed.
-
Serve as the primary liaison with regulatory agencies.
-
Conduct internal safety audits, inspections, and hazard assessments.
-
Identify safety issues and lead the implementation of corrective actions and safety improvements.
-
Partner with cross-functional teams to drive safety performance and ensure ongoing compliance.
-
Monitor and communicate regulatory changes that may impact operations.
-
Participate in safety and workers’ compensation due diligence and investigation efforts.
Qualifications:
-
Minimum of five years of experience in an occupational safety role, preferably within a manufacturing environment.
-
In-depth knowledge of OSHA and MSHA regulations.
-
Demonstrated experience with regulatory compliance, ergonomic hazard mitigation, and safety program management.
-
Bachelor’s degree in Safety, Industrial Engineering, Environmental Health, or a related field.
-
Strong interpersonal, communication, and facilitation skills with the ability to influence at all organizational levels.
-
Proven ability to manage multiple priorities and work independently.
-
Willingness and ability to travel regularly to company sites.
